Eden Brown Synergy are currently looking for an experienced Senior Social Worker / Advanced Practitioner to join the Children in Care (CIC) Team for Barnet Council.
Duties and Responsibilities:
* Manage a caseload of Children in Care, ensuring statutory visits, reviews, and care plans are completed within timescales.
* Undertake comprehensive assessments and develop robust, outcome-focused care and pathway plans.
* Lead on complex and high-risk cases, providing expert practice support within the team.
* Work in partnership with children, families, carers, and multi-agency professionals to achieve permanence and stability.
* Prepare high-quality court reports and contribute to care proceedings where required.
* Maintain accurate, up-to-date case recordings in line with statutory and local authority requirements.

Essential Requirements:
* Social Work Qualification - Degree or equivalent
* Minimum 3+ years' experience in children's social care, ideally within Children in Care
* Experience working at Senior Social Worker or Advanced Practitioner level
* Social Work England Registration
* Strong knowledge of relevant legislation, including Children Act 1989 and care planning regulations
